Mustangs on a three-game win streak

Prairieview Ogden’s baseball team bounced back from losses in its first two games by compiling a three-game winning streak.

The Mustangs scored a 4-1 win on Tuesday (Aug. 16) at home against Hoopeston Area behind a two-hit pitching performance by Lane McKinney.

He struck out eight and walked no one in his complete-game, seven-inning outing.

McKinney had two hits as did Dalton York.

On Monday (Aug. 15), PVO recorded a 19-1 win over Heritage at Homer.

McKinney, York and Jameson Ehler all poked two hits. Royce Loschen scored four runs. Touching home plate three times each were York, Garrett Loschen and Wedig.

Garrett Loschen earned the win. He worked 2 1/3 innings and fanned four batters. Royce Loschen pitched the last 1 2/3 innings. He yielded no hits and struck out two batters.

On Saturday (Aug. 13), the Mustangs registered a 7-0 win at home over Salt Fork.

Wedig was on the mound for the first 4 1/3 innings. He permitted one hit and struck out seven. York went 2 1/3 innings and collected four strikeouts. McKinney got the final out via a strikeout.

York tallied three runs and landed three hits. Ehler knocked in three runs. Casen Goff contributed two hits.

On Thursday (Aug. 11), PVO dropped a 3-0 decision at Champaign Edison.

Ehler allowed six hits in six innings and suffered the loss.

McKinney had two of the Mustangs’ three hits. Royce Loschen had the team’s other hit.

PVO (3-2) returns to action on Wednesday (Aug. 17) at Rantoul Eater.
